Fit for a celebrity

As you pull up to Joe Saccone and Rick
Hauck’s Hyde Park Prime Steakhouse, a
young man happily greets you and takes
your keys for valet parking. You enter the
restaurant and are shown to your table
with all the attention given to a movie star
— surrounded by the host, a manager and
multiple waiters. They greet you, confirm
that you’re comfortable and are eager to
help clarify the menu and make recommendations.

Throughout the meal, your waiters and the
manager check in often, making sure your
every whim is met promptly and completely, but your dining experience doesn’t end
when you leave the restaurant — expect a
follow-up call from a manager the next day
to ensure everything was perfect.

The Hyde Park staff strives to give each
customer more than just a nice meal and is
willing to sacrifice immediate profits to do
so. In one instance, a regional manager
sent a valet out in search of fast food for a
disgruntled 5-year-old diner who only
wanted a Happy Meal. They surprised and
impressed both the frustrated mother and
the young connoisseur, when the girl’s
hamburger arrived — toy included — on a
silver platter.

While the steakhouse strives to make
every guest feel important, it also has special services for its VIPs by reserving several tables during the dinner rush in case
they need a last-minute reservation, providing a special appetizer from the chef for
them and placing a special gift with a personalized note on the VIP’s car seat, such
as gourmet chocolates or nuts.

With these little touches, whether
you’re hosting an upscale dinner meeting
or simply taking the family out for a bite
to eat, you can expect a world-class experience at Hyde Park Prime Steakhouse.
